The year is 1943 and we’re losing the war. Luckily, we’re about to gamble all our futures on a stolen corpse.
Operation Mincemeat is the fast-paced, hilarious and unbelievable true story of the twisted secret mission that won the Allies World War II. The question is, how did a well-dressed corpse wrong-foot Hitler?
Operation Mincemeat (Expanded Cast Version) is a full-length adaptation of the Broadway and West End hit, featuring up to 87 characters.
After premiering in 2019, with London stagings at the New Diorama Theatre (2019), Southwark Playhouse (2020, ’21 and ’22) and Riverside Studios (2022), Operation Mincemeat made its West End premiere at the Fortune Theatre on 29 March 2023. Two years later, on 20 March 2025, the musical made its Broadway premiere at the John Golden Theatre.
Principal Roles
EWEN MONTAGU – (Man, 30) The “host” of the show (at least in his mind), Montagu is charming, confident and very much used to getting what he wants as a result. A member of the elite upper classes, he’s the definition of privilege and is determined to be having the most fun possible in any situation.CHARLES CHOLMONDELEY – (Man, 24) [pronounced “Chumley”] The man behind the plan, Charles has most of the advantages Montagu has in life, and yet has never quite managed to fit in. Awkward, cripplingly shy and a slave to perfection, he’d rather be off studying a rare form of newt than be in the spotlight.JOHNNY BEVAN – (Man, 48) Colonel Bevan is the Head of Military Deception. Painfully serious and often despairing at the maniacs he has working for him, he is our reminder of what’s at stake during the operation. Although he and Montagu are often at odds, he’s not an antagonist; he’s a man with a huge weight on his shoulders trying to get the job done.HESTER LEGGATT – (Woman, 45) Bevan’s incredibly capable and trusted right-hand woman, Hester is reserved and often comes across as severe to her colleagues. However, underneath her stern exterior and strong sense of duty lies a genuine warmth and desire to connect with the people around her in a deeper way.JEAN LESLIE – (Woman, 20) Young, smart and ambitious, Jean cannot believe the opportunity she’s getting in working at MI-bloody-5! Impatient and outspoken (sometimes to a fault, sometimes to her advantage), she’s constantly pushing against the boundaries of what is expected of her as a young woman in a man’s world.
Ensemble & Principal Doubling Roles
MI5 & GOVERNMENT EMPLOYEES
HASELDEN – (Man, 60s) An impossibly sweaty, anxious British diplomat from the West Country caught up in the mission despite being way out of his depth.STEVE – (Man, 60s) Haselden’s doddery right-hand idiot.IAN FLEMING – (Man, 20s) Technically in his 20s but played as a cheerfully mad 12-year-old boy. Fleming works at MI5 but is completely obsessed with his creation James Bond.JOHN MASTERMAN & REGGIE TAR – (Men, 50s) Old Etonians with absolutely insane plans for killing Hitler.MERYL, BERYL & CHERYL – (Women, 20s) The women working in the secretarial staff at MI5, they’re young and ditzy but ambitious, and boy can they dance.ADMIRAL GOUT, ADMIRAL PLUMP, ADMIRAL GUFF – (Men, 90s) Ancient, dusty men of the sea.MI5 AGENTS & SECRETARIES – Additional workers in the MI5 offices
SUBMARINERS
CAPTAIN JEWELL – (Man, 40s) An incredibly serious submarine captain, the only person in the show to successfully intimidate Montagu.CHIEF WALKER, BOSUN, COXON & DOUGLASS – (Men, Various ages) Submariners are our connection to the seriousness of war. They’re not comedy characters and during Act One, Scene Eight they should be naturalistic, a reminder of the stakes of the mission.
LONDONERS
SIR BERNARD SPILSBURY – (Man, 50s) If Liberace was obsessed with corpses. Spilsbury is a showman and a maniac, he loves the spotlight and all things blood and gore.SPILSBURY ASSISTANTS – Half showgirl, half goblin; Spilsbury’s creepy and glamorous sidekicks.THE COCKNEYS – Heel-clicking, flat-cap wearing Newsie-style boys.SHOESHINE BOY – A cheerful shoe-shining orphan who’s somehow fallen out of a Dickens novel into this show.TAILOR – Quite literally… a tailor.UMBRELLA MAN – A nonplussed passerby (carrying an umbrella, of course).WAITERS – Waiters at the Ritz, moustaches preferredMARY PIGGLES – (Woman, 40s) A slow-moving barmaid with a truly hideous smile.IVOR MONTAGU – (Man, 20s) Monty’s younger brother, an enigmatic filmmaker (and possible Communist spy).HEL – (Woman, 20s) Ivor’s glamorous wife.DANCERS, CLUBBERS, BARMEN & PATRONS – An array of characters that move and transform throughout Act One, Scene 8. They are found in The Milky Pig, Clinky’s, Baby Sam’s Brass Bonanza, Mama Maracas, and many other London bars during Montagu and Cholmondeley’s night out.
SPANISH MORGUE
DR POBIL – (Men, 40s) A highly competent Spanish coroner.JUAN & JOSÉ – (Men, 20s) Dr Pobil’s assistants.
ADDITIONAL CHARACTERS
NAZI OFFICERS – Members of a sexy Nazi boy band – think Backstreet Boys meets BTS.GERMAN SPIES – Spies who take the bait from HaseldenAMBASSADOR’S BALL ATTENDEES – Masked DancersWILLIE WATKINS – (Man, 20s) Unbelievably cheery all-American crooner who turns up unannounced, with an annoying cartoonish ability to pop up in unexpected locations.WILLIE’S SHOWGIRLS – (Women) Wide-eyed and even wider smiles; Willie Watkins’s glitzy USA cheerleaders who transform into glitzy Nazi cheerleaders mid-song.MOVIE CHORUS – A typical Broadway dancing chorus, giving 110%.TUB – An American actor playing Cholmondeley in Montagu’s movie (must be played by the person playing Cholmondeley).
Actor Assignments
Please note: Operation Mincemeat (Expanded Cast Edition) requires a minimum cast size of 13 actors. Licensees are welcome to expand the cast further by removing doubling and/or utilizing a chorus of any size. A large-format roadmap, with character assignments by scene, is provided to licensees with their music rehearsal package.
PRINCIPAL CAST
ACTOR 1 – EWEN MONTAGU; Doubles as NAZI OFFICER and JUANACTOR 2 – CHARLES CHOLMONDELEY; Doubles as NAZI OFFICER, DR POBIL and TUBACTOR 3 – JOHNNY BEVAN; Doubles as NAZI OFFICER and HASELDENACTOR 4 – HESTER LEGGATT; Doubles as COXON, NAZI OFFICER and JOSÉACTOR 5 – JEAN LESLIE Doubles as BOSUN, NAZI OFFICER and STEVE
ENSEMBLE CAST
ACTOR 6 – Doubles as REGGIE TAR, MERYL, ADMIRAL PLUMP, CLUBBER, HEL,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and GERMAN SPYACTOR 7 – Doubles as JOHN MASTERMAN, CHERYL, ADMIRAL GOUT,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and DOUGLASSACTOR 8 – Doubles as IAN FLEMING, BERYL, ADMIRAL GUFF, MARY PIGGLES, CLUBBER, IVOR MONTAGU,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and GERMAN SPY, MAKE-UP ARTISTACTOR 9 – Doubles as MI5 AGENT, BERNARD SPILSBURY, CAPTAIN BILL JEWELL,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and WILLIE WATKINSACTOR 10 – Doubles as MI5 AGENT, SECRETARY, COCKNEY 1, WAITER 1, CHIEF WALKER, AMBASSADOR’S BALL ATTENDEE, SHOWGIRL,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and MOVIE CHORUS MEMBERACTOR 11 – Doubles as MI5 AGENT, SECRETARY, COCKNEY 3, WAITER 2, SUBMARINER, CLINKY’S PATRON, BABY SAM’S DANCER, MAMA MARACAS DANCER, CLUBBER, AMBASSADOR’S BALL ATTENDEE, SHOWGIRL,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and MOVIE CHORUS MEMBERACTOR 12 – Doubles as MI5 AGENT, SECRETARY, UMBRELLA MAN, SHOESHINE BOY, MORGUE ASSISTANT 1, SUBMARINER, CLINKY’S WAITER, BABY SAM’S DANCER, BOUNCER & CLUBBER, AMBASSADOR’S BALL ATTENDEE, SHOWGIRL,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and MOVIE CHORUS MEMBERACTOR 13 – Doubles as MI5 AGENT, SECRETARY, COCKNEY 2, MORGUE ASSISTANT 2, TAILOR, SUBMARINER, CLINKY’S BARMAN, BABY SAM’S DANCER, MAMA MARACAS DANCER, CLUBBER, AMBASSADOR’S BALL ATTENDEE, SHOWGIRL, NAZI OFFICER (CHORUS) and MOVIE CHORUS MEMBER
Notes on gender and casting: The gender swapping should not be pointed, exaggerated, or even acknowledged. It should simply be part of the fabric of the show. It’s just more fun that way.
ACTOR 1 (MONTAGU) should not be played by a cis man.ACTOR 4 (HESTER) should not be played by a cis woman.All other roles can be played by an actor of any gender.
